"Rare Find: Ancient Roman Swords Unearthed in Israeli Dead Sea Cave"

Four Roman-era swords, along with their wooden and leather hilts and scabbards, have been discovered in a well-preserved state in a desert cave near the Dead Sea in Israel. The artifacts, believed to have been hidden by Jewish rebels during an uprising against the Roman Empire in the 130s, provide insights into empire and rebellion. The swords, which have not yet been radiocarbon dated, were likely crafted in a European province and brought to Judaea by Roman soldiers. The discovery highlights the exceptional preservation of organic remains in the desert caves, including the famous Dead Sea Scrolls. Future research will focus on studying the swords' manufacture and the history of the objects and the people they belonged to.
